Real-world Lithium Intake

Recruiting now

Conditions studied: Bipolar Disorder (BD)

In brief

The aim of the present study is to study compliance with lithium therapy and patterns of lithium intake among a representative group of patients with bipolar disorder in a real-world clinical setting. This will be studied via a pill box that registers the daily time when the participant took the lithium tablet out of the pill box, representing a proxy for the actual lithium intake. Participants will receive a weekly phone call asking for several aspects of lithium intake.
